He is looking distressed with that black beard. So I wouldn't treat it as brumation right now.
I highly recommend trying to do some nebulization treatments on him. That helps tremendously
when they have respiratory issues. He will need to start them immediately, can you get one from
your vet? If not, check with the local drug store to see if you can find a nebulizer. You can use
a sterile saline solution z for treatment if you don't have anymore medication.
Also, can you place him on a slight decline overnight, to help any fluids drain from his lungs,
in case some have been aspirated.
